Toledo's Non-Conference Schedule for 2024-25 Season Finalized

Rockets to visit two of nation's top programs with December games at Houston and Purdue

5/9/2024 9:38:00 AM

TOLEDO, Ohio - The four-time defending Mid-American Conference champion University of Toledo men's basketball team will face two of the top programs in the country as part of its 2024-25 non-conference schedule, Head Coach Tod Kowalczyk announced today.

Highlighting the Rockets' slate are games at Houston (Dec. 18) and Purdue (Dec. 29). The Cougars and Boilermakers were each No. 1 seeds in last year's NCAA Tournament, with Purdue dropping a 75-60 decision to UConn in the national title game. Houston has advanced to five consecutive Sweet 16s and reached the 2021 Final Four.

"We have a tremendous schedule ahead of us," said Kowalczyk, who is one of five active NCAA head coaches to win four straight outright league titles. "We want to play the best of the best, and Purdue and Houston are definitely rank right up there. These types of games help our recruiting and are exciting for our fan base. Our players are going to learn a lot when they see how hard those two teams play."

Toledo will open its season on Nov. 4 against an opponent to be determined as part of the MAC-Sun Belt Conference Challenge. The Rockets will then head to Marshall on Nov. 9 before hosting Wright State in its home opener on Nov. 13. Following its contest against the Raiders, UT will visit Detroit Mercy on Nov. 16 before competing at the Boardwalk Battle in Daytona Beach, Fla. on Nov. 21-23.

The Rockets will return to Savage Arena for home games vs. Oakland (Nov. 30) and Defiance College (Dec. 7) before closing out the calendar year at Youngstown State (Dec. 14) along with their games at Houston and Purdue. Toledo's final non-conference contest will be a home game on Feb. 8 as part of the MAC-SBC Challenge.

"We're going to be facing some really good teams in Florida and we'll be challenged," Kowalczyk said. "We also have some tough road games against Marshall, Youngstown State and in the MAC-Sun Belt Challenge."

Toledo continued its historic run last year by joining former MAC member Cincinnati (1951-54) as the only two MAC programs ever to win four consecutive outright league titles. The Rockets are returning two starters from last year's squad that posted a 20-12 overall record and 14-4 league mark. Sophomore forward Javan Simmons (12.2 ppg, 5.0 rpg) earned MAC Freshman of the Year honors, while sophomore guard Sonny Wilson (8.0 ppg, 2.2 apg) was named to the MAC All-Freshman Team.

UT has a talented group of newcomers joining its program for the 2024-25 campaign. The Rockets are adding all-state honorees Tyler Ode (Saginaw, Mich.) and Jaylan Ouwinga (Grand Rapids, Mich.) as well as transfers Isaiah Adams (12.8 ppg, 4.0 rpg, 3.7 apg at Buffalo), Seth Hubbard (14.1 ppg, 3.4 rpg at WMU), and Colin O'Rourke (17. 5 ppg, 6.2 rpg at Wisconsin-Parkside).

Toledo's Mid-American Conference schedule is expected to be announced in late August or early September.
